AdSense pays you for a video two months late. The brand wired $4,500 when the contract said $5,000. The PR haul on your desk is taxable income. Post stitches your bank, platforms, and deals into one number — written in creator ("brand deal," "gifted"), not accountant ("4000 · Revenue — Services").
Post recalculates what you owe every time money lands — your state, your filing status, your real deductions, not a flat 30% — and tells you exactly what to set aside this month so the quarterly deadline is a number, not a panic. Planning estimates only — confirm with your CPA before paying.
A full draft return — Schedule C, every number filled in from the year you already tracked. File it yourself with the step-by-step guide, hand your CPA a package they'll actually thank you for, or add the $299 CPA-filed return. Your call, zero re-typing.

Most creator finance tools try to replace your accountant. Post doesn’t. If you already have a CPA you trust, give them access — they’ll see your books in proper accounting language, and they’ll be ready to file in minutes instead of hours.
Invite your CPA as a collaborator. They get their own view of your finances — no extra login, no extra charge.
They see journal entries, financial statements, and tax-ready exports — everything they expect, the way they expect it.
Comment on any transaction. Flag items. Post adjusting entries alongside yours. All in one place.
When April hits, they're not asking you for a spreadsheet. They already have everything.
Most CPAs tell us Post saves them hours per creator client. Your accountant keeps the strategy work. The data entry goes away.

Platforms that pay two months late, brand wires that come in short, bank deposits with no label — pulled in, deduped, and stitched together so "what did I actually make?" always has an answer.
Brand deal tracker
Every deal from draft → active → delivered → invoiced → paid, with deliverables and contract upload. Know exactly who owes you.
Gifted product FMV + usage
PR packages show up as income at fair market value. Tag them for-content, personal, or returning — we keep them out of your tax bill when appropriate.
Snap a photo or forward an email. Post reads the merchant, total, tax, and line items, then stitches it to the matching bank charge — scan first or charge first, same result.
Your bank feed syncs nightly. AI files each charge into the right tax bucket the night it posts, and links it to any receipt you already scanned.
Federal, self-employment, state — calculated live so you always know what to set aside. CPA-reviewed math, not a flat 30%.
We match every 1099 against the income we already tracked. Mismatches and missing forms get flagged before the IRS finds them.
Every number you'll need, line by line — ready to drop into TurboTax, FreeTaxUSA, H&R Block, or Cash App Taxes. About 20 minutes to file.
Target, current balance, remaining owed — with reminders 7 days, 1 day, and day-of each estimated-payment deadline.

Creator tax is full of edge cases — gifted product FMV, 1099 mismatches, state nexus, the OBBBA brackets that just changed. Every number you see in Post is either calculated from first principles or reviewed by a licensed CPA. That's the whole job.
Every tax rule is written up, cited (IRS code, Treasury regs, state law), and logged before a line of code gets written.
Engineer translates the spec into code. Golden-value tests lock the exact numbers we expect the engine to produce.
Our in-house CPA reviews every tax calculation before it ships. When the IRS rules change, they update the math — you don't.
Tests run on every pull request. A change that breaks a tax number can't reach production until the CPA signs off again.
